Miten pystyy fiksusti valvomaan muuttuuko jokin MySQL:n taulun kentän sisältö? Onko tähän parempaa vaihtoehtoa kuin timer joka katsoo kentän sisällön halutuin väliajoin?
MySQL kentän sisällön valvonta?
2
338
Vastaukset
- Nimimerkki
Tämä ei liity VB:n mitenkään, mutta katsohan tuosta vinkkiä;
http://dev.mysql.com/doc/refman/5.0/en/triggers.html
Tietokanta pitää siis itse silmällä sitä jos kenttä muuttuu. Sun pitää kuitenkin tehdä ohjelmalogiikkaan jokin joka huomaa tietokannan antaman infon. - .........................
No siis timer-systeemi on ihan hyvä mielestäni jos vaadetta samanaikaisuudelle (tyyliin 0,5 sekuntia havaitsemisväli ohjelmiston ja tietokannan välillä...) ei ole...
Itse toteuttaisin sellaisen yleisen "tarkkailu" järjestelmän jota voisi käskyttää muissakin vastaavissa tapauksissa. Ylläpitorutiineja yms. varten.
Joku tuolla mainitsikin jo triggerit... itse en niiden perusteella lähtisi kovin monimutkaista / vaatimuksiltaan kovaa softaa väsäämään esim. kahden eri järjestelmän välille. Tulee helposti ns. Race-condition ja siitä aiheutuvia kryptisiä virheitä.
Vai mahtuuko triggeri transaktion sisään? Entä suorituskyky-penaltti?
Ketjusta on poistettu 0 sääntöjenvastaista viestiä.
Luetuimmat keskustelut
Tänään pyörit ajatuksissa enemmän, kun erehdyin lukemaan palstaa
En saisi, silti toivon että sinä vielä palaat ja otetaan oikeasti selvää, hioituuko särmät ja sulaudummeko yhteen. Vuod225134- 254308
- 272461
- 342234
- 371998
- 151908
En ole koskaan kokenut
Ennen mitään tällaista rakastumista. Tiedän että kaipaan sinua varmaan loppu elämän. Toivottavasti ei tarvitsisi vain ka191587- 121521
Voi ei! Jari Sillanpää heitti keikan Helsingissä - Hämmästyttävä hetki lavalla...
Ex-tangokuningas on parhaillaan konserttikiertueella. Hän esiintyi Savoy teatterissa äitienpäivänä. Sillanpää jakoi kons211247Kerranki asiat oikein
Ilkka ja muut pienpuolueeet...teitte hyvän työn kun valitsitte pätevän henkilön virkaan eikä kepulle passelia!! Jatkakaa101164